Transaction 11e8641582fa83361e5530da50cb4c139dc538684808d6b3691df2eae683f69e
1 Input
1 Output
-
11e8641582fa83361e5530da50cb4c139dc538684808d6b3691df2eae683f69e:0
- value
- 2296446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f71982c6e3050024d78b06c8a4c34bd171e7e965 OP_EQUAL
- address
- 3QDZPT679Cnc1mCHfxJLGGMjFaAQEzo6vD